Sony Xperia U vs Sony Xperia M Dual
Here you can compare Sony Xperia U and Sony Xperia M Dual. Comparing Sony Xperia U vs Sony Xperia M Dual on Smartprix enables you to check their respective specs scores and unique features. It would potentially help you understand how Sony Xperia U stands against Sony Xperia M Dual and which one should you buy The current lowest price found for Sony Xperia U is ₹8,901 and for Sony Xperia M Dual is ₹6,990. The details of both of these products were last updated on Mar 22, 2024.
Specification | Sony Xperia U | Sony Xperia M Dual |
---|---|---|
OS | Android v2.3 (Gingerbread) | Android v4.2 (Jelly Bean) |
Battery | 1320 mAh, Li-ion Battery | 1750 mAh, Li-ion Battery |
Display | 3.5 inches, 480 x 854 pixels | 4 inches, 480 x 854 pixels |
Internal Memory | 8 GB | 4 GB |
CPU | 1 GHz, Dual Core Processor | 1 GHz, Dual Core Processor |
Price | ₹8,901 | ₹6,990 |

General
Sim Type | Single Sim, GSM | Dual Sim, GSM+GSM |
Dual Sim | No | Yes |
Device Type | Smartphone | Smartphone |
Release Date | February, 2012 | June, 2013 |
Design
Dimensions | 54 x 112 x 12 mm | 62 x 124 x 9.3 mm |
Weight | 110 g | 115 g |
Display
Type | Color TFT Screen (16M colors Colors) | Color TFT Screen (16M colors Colors) |
Touch | Yes | Yes |
Size | 3.5 inches, 480 x 854 pixels | 4 inches, 480 x 854 pixels |
Aspect Ratio | 16:9 | 16:9 |
PPI | ~ 280 PPI | ~ 245 PPI |
Memory
RAM | 512 MB | 1 GB |
Storage | 8 GB | 4 GB |
Card Slot | No | Yes, upto 32 GB |
